HTML基础知识
HTML(HyperText Markup Language,超文本标记语言)是一种用于创建网页的标准标记语言,它可以用来描述网页的结构,包括文本、图像、链接等元素,HTML使用一系列预定义的标签来表示这些元素,而浏览器则负责解析这些标签并将其显示为可视化的网页。
HTML判断语句的写法
在HTML中,我们通常不直接编写判断语句,而是通过JavaScript来实现,JavaScript是一种脚本语言,它可以在浏览器端执行,用于实现网页的动态效果,下面是一个JavaScript的判断语句的例子:
if (条件) { // 如果条件为真,执行这里的代码 } else { // 如果条件为假,执行这里的代码 }
在这个例子中,“条件”可以是任何可以被转换为布尔值的表达式,如果我们想要检查一个表单是否已经被填写,我们可以这样写:
if (document.getElementById("myForm").checkValidity()) { // 如果表单已经被填写,执行这里的代码 } else { // 如果表单还没有被填写,执行这里的代码 }
HTML判断语句的应用实例
假设我们有一个表单,用户可以在其中输入他们的名字和年龄,当用户提交表单时,我们可能希望根据用户输入的信息向他们发送个性化的消息,如果用户输入了他们的名字和年龄,我们就向他们发送一条欢迎消息;如果用户没有输入名字或年龄,我们就向他们发送一条警告消息,这可以通过JavaScript来判断实现:
<form id="myForm"> <label for="name">Name:</label><br> <input type="text" id="name" name="name"><br> <label for="age">Age:</label><br> <input type="text" id="age" name="age"><br> <input type="submit" value="Submit"> </form> <script> document.getElementById("myForm").onsubmit = function(event) { event.preventDefault(); // 阻止表单的默认提交行为 var name = document.getElementById("name").value; // 获取用户输入的名字 var age = document.getElementById("age").value; // 获取用户输入的年龄 if (name && age) { // 如果用户输入了名字和年龄 alert("Welcome, " + name + "! You are " + age + " years old."); // 向用户发送欢迎消息 } else { // 如果用户没有输入名字或年龄 alert("Please enter your name and age."); // 向用户发送警告消息 } }; </script>
相关问题与解答
问题1:HTML中的JavaScript代码应该放在HTML的哪个部分?
答:JavaScript代码应该放在HTML的<script>
标签中,这个标签可以放在HTML的任何位置,但是通常我们会把它放在<body>
标签的底部,或者放在一个单独的.js
文件中,这样可以确保页面加载完成后再执行JavaScript代码。
原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/156796.html